What is calculate biological age?
To calculate biological age is to measure how your body is functioning relative to your actual years on the calendar. While chronological age is a fixed number based on your birth date, biological age (also known as physiological age) reflects the wear and tear on your cells, organs, and systems. When you calculate biological age, you are essentially looking at a "health clock" that can be faster or slower than the passage of time.
Who should use this? Anyone interested in longevity, biohacking, or preventative health should regularly calculate biological age. It serves as a powerful motivator for lifestyle changes. A common misconception is that biological age is permanent; in reality, you can lower it through targeted interventions like diet, exercise, and stress management.

Practical Examples (Real-World Use Cases)
Example 1: The High-Stress Executive
John is 45 years old. He smokes, has a BMI of 31, and high blood pressure (150 mmHg). When we calculate biological age for John, the formula adds 7 years for smoking, 3 years for obesity, and 4 years for hypertension. His biological age is 59, meaning his body is 14 years "older" than his peers.
Example 2: The Health Enthusiast
Sarah is 50 years old. She exercises daily, eats a plant-rich diet, and has a BMI of 21. When we calculate biological age for Sarah, the formula subtracts 3 years for fitness, 2 years for diet, and 2 years for optimal BMI. Her biological age is 43, showing she has successfully slowed her aging process.

Key Factors That Affect calculate biological age Results
When you calculate biological age, several critical factors influence the final number:
- Cardiovascular Health: High blood pressure strains the arteries and accelerates cellular aging.
- Metabolic Health: BMI and blood sugar levels determine how efficiently your body processes energy.
- Oxidative Stress: Smoking introduces toxins that cause direct DNA damage, significantly increasing the result when you calculate biological age.
- Physical Activity: Regular movement maintains telomere length, which is a key marker of cellular youth.
- Sleep Quality: During sleep, the body performs essential repairs. Chronic sleep deprivation can add years to your physiological profile.
- Nutrient Density: A diet high in antioxidants combats the inflammation that drives the aging process.
